On 6/01/2007 10:01 AM, Axel Thimm wrote:
On Sat, Jan 06, 2007 at 09:57:42AM +1100, Paul wrote:
Here is my output:
[EMAIL PROTECTED] X11]# ls -l
Manually created symlink:
ln -s /usr/lib/xorg/modules/drivers/nvidia-1.0-9746_drv.so nvidia_drv.so
and removed bad symlink
rm nvidia_drv.o
rebooted and nvidia loaded ok
